    Strange quarterly sequences between #flare and #transit which i don't think i ve seen through data sets before. Its most Probably #contamination of sorts but the impact and influence(s) that's coming through the data is unusually bipolar with fairly good frequency/ timing.
    Q1.1 - 1.3 Transit features
    Q2,1 - 2.3 Flares.
    Q3.1 - 3.3 Mixed with both
    Q4.1 - 4.3 Quieter
    Q5.1 - 5.3 Transits again
    Q6.1 - 6.3 Flares return
    Q7.1 - 7.3 Mixture of both again
    Q8.1 - 8.2 Transits mostly
    Q9.1 - 9.3 Flares then return
    Q10.1 - 10.3 Transits features take over
    Q11.1 - 11.3 Flares star up agin
    Q12.1 - 12.3 Flares are more intense
    Q13.1 - 13.3 Benign. very few of both
    Q14.1 - 14.3 Flares return back
    Q15.1 - 15.3 Transit features slowly build back
    Q16.1 - 16.3 Transit then flares
    Q17.1 - 17.3 Flares transgress to dips

    We have the latest processing of the Kepler light curves loaded in this version of Planet Hunters. So there could be somethings that the latest version of the Kepler processing pipeline that makes the PDC light curves now retains as stellar signal rather than removing.
